The "LPR-VN Series" is a compact type of permanent lifting magnet that demonstrates its power in lifting workpieces in narrow spaces or on small contact surfaces. The handle operation angle is 60°, and it is patented. All models are compatible with steel plates and round steel, and they feature a double handle lock mechanism designed with safety in mind. We also offer larger types such as the "LPH Series" and the shape steel lifting type "LPR-VN+L Series." 【Features】 ■ Compact type ■ Handle operation angle of 60° ■ Suitable for lifting workpieces in narrow spaces or on small contact surfaces ■ Compatible with steel plates and round steel ■ Double handle lock mechanism *For more details, please refer to the PDF document or feel free to contact us.

Kanetec Co., Ltd. has focused on the fascinating appeal created by magnetism and has developed numerous products as a comprehensive manufacturer of magnetic application equipment for over 60 years since its founding. Our unique magnet technology, cultivated over many years, has received broad support in various fields, including machine tools, industrial robots, food and chemicals, and even the environment. Currently, we have established a consistent system from development to manufacturing and sales, boasting a top-level share in the domestic market for magnetic application equipment.
